Can minerals in a rock change?

Metamorphic rocks form when the minerals in an existing rock are changed by heat or pressure within the Earth. See figure 6 for an example of a metamorphic rock. Figure 6. Quartzite is a metamorphic rock formed when quartz sandstone is exposed to heat and pressure within the Earth.

Do rocks ever stop changing?

Most changes happen very slowly; many take place below the Earth’s surface, so we may not even notice the changes. Although we may not see the changes, the physical and chemical properties of rocks are constantly changing in a natural, never-ending cycle called the rock cycle.

Can rocks actually change?

If we take a step back to look at geologic time (which focuses on changes taking place over millions of years), we find that rocks actually do change! All rocks, in fact, change slowly from one type to another, again and again. The changes form a cycle, called “the rock cycle.”

    What are 3 ways in which minerals form?

    Minerals can form in three primary ways being precipitation, crystallization from a magma and solid- state transformation by chemical reactions (metamorphism). Mineral Precipitation is when a mineral is formed by crystallization from a solution. Examples include quartz, halite (table salt), calcite, and gypsum.
